Output 22caf4844e99c6c4548c0bef81b8a4699ecb8e17a19876263a8b82b60bc1fc30:3

value
23790449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d94ec184542155a594431a2ddc1f923e5dee07d OP_EQUAL
address
3JyS36gK63o7TbJzqvTxTZqXSLUU1JnvmN
transaction
22caf4844e99c6c4548c0bef81b8a4699ecb8e17a19876263a8b82b60bc1fc30
spent
true